Job description

Haus is seeking a UI Designer to join our Los Angeles team. In this role, you will build and maintain high-fidelity design system components in Figma, translating system logic into polished, reusable, and on-brand UI elements. You will report to the Creative Director and partner closely with UX Designers to ensure every component is well-crafted visually and structurally sound. Requirements

What you'll do

  • Build and maintain high-fidelity UI components in Figma leveraging best practices: auto layout, variants, components, etc.
  • Manage and update design token architecture to support seamless theming and platform scaling
  • Organize and maintain icon libraries, illustration sets, and other shared visual assets
  • Support accessibility checks on components, particularly around color contrast, legibility and visual hierarchy
  • Draft release notes and change logs summarizing what's new, changed, or deprecated with each system update
  • Support visual QA of engineering implementations against Figma source files

Requirements

  • 3+ years of user interface design experience with deep understanding of component libraries and design systems
  • Expert-level Figma skills, including auto layout, variants, components and tokens
  • Strong visual design fundamentals in typography, color, spacing, and layout
  • Familiarity with design token architecture and how tokens map across themes and platforms
  • Working knowledge of accessibility standards (contrast ratios, touch target sizing)
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
